Why a B2B Marketing Calendar is Critical in 2025

b2b marketing calendar acts as a blueprint for your entire marketing strategy, helping you manage time, allocate resources, and stay ahead of key dates such as product launches, industry events, and seasonal opportunities. In an increasingly complex marketing landscape, it provides the clarity needed to coordinate efforts across teams and maintain consistent messaging that resonates with prospects and customers.

Steps to Create a Winning B2B Marketing Calendar for 2025

1. Define Your Marketing Goals and Objectives

Start your b2b marketing calendar by clearly defining what you want to achieve in 2025. Goals could range from increasing brand awareness, generating qualified leads, supporting sales enablement, to customer retention. These goals become the anchor that guides the types of campaigns you’ll plan and the metrics you’ll track.

2. Map Out Key Dates and Milestones

Identify important internal and external dates to include in your b2b marketing calendar. This includes:

  • Product launches and updates
  • Industry conferences, trade shows, and webinars
  • Holidays and seasonal events relevant to your industry
  • Annual company milestones and campaigns

By aligning marketing efforts with these dates, you can capitalize on natural spikes in interest and create timely, relevant content.

3. Collaborate with Cross-Functional Teams

Ensure that your b2b marketing calendar reflects input from sales, product teams, customer success, and other stakeholders. Collaboration guarantees alignment across departments, helping plan campaigns that address real customer pain points and sales challenges while coordinating timing for maximum effect.

4. Choose Marketing Themes and Campaign Types

Organize your calendar by monthly or quarterly themes that support your overall strategy. Mix campaign types including content marketing (blogs, whitepapers), paid ads, email nurturing, webinars, and social media outreach to diversify engagement and fuel the lead funnel consistently.

5. Allocate Campaign Frequencies and Set Deadlines

Decide how often to publish or launch initiatives to maintain audience interest without overload. Plotting deadlines for content creation, reviews, approvals, and launches within your b2b marketing calendar ensures accountability and timely execution.

6. Assign Responsibilities

Clearly assign task owners for each calendar item, whether it’s content writing, design, social posting, or email deployment. A well-defined b2b marketing calendar with assigned accountability improves team productivity and communication.

7. Incorporate Flexibility and Review Periods

Marketing needs to be adaptive; build flexibility into your b2b marketing calendar to accommodate last-minute opportunities, industry changes, or learnings from previous campaigns. Regular review meetings help your team stay agile and optimize ongoing efforts.

8. Use Marketing Tools to Manage Your Calendar

Leverage platforms like HubSpot, Asana, Trello, or Wrike to create and manage your b2b marketing calendar digitally. These tools provide visibility, streamline collaboration, and help track progress against goals.

Best Practices to Optimize Your B2B Marketing Calendar

  • Data-Driven Planning: Use analytics and past campaign performance to prioritize content and channels that deliver the best ROI.
  • Audience Segmentation: Tailor your campaigns in the calendar by buyer personas and funnel stages to increase relevance and impact.
  • Content Repurposing: Plan to extend the reach of your assets by repurposing them across formats and channels within your calendar.
  • Integrate Paid and Organic Efforts: Coordinate paid social, search ads, and organic content for cohesive messaging and amplification.
  • Measure and Adjust: Track KPIs regularly and update the calendar to reflect what’s working and opportunities for improvement.
